Summary for Field Activity Number 1990-047-FA

Alternate Leg ID: WCMA90-1; STRESS LEG 1

Area of Operations: northern California Continental Shelf, California, United States, North America, North Pacific

Dates: November 14, 1990 to November 17, 1990

Objectives: Deploy surface marker buoys and 3 current moorings on California continental shelf in Sediment TRansport Events on Shelves and Slopes (STRESS) experiment to study resuspension/transport of fine-grained sediments in winter storms at sites C2, C3, and C4.
